On Tuesday, February 7, FORA.tv, the leading online destination for video programs from the world’s best conferences and events, will broadcast the next Intelligence Squared U.S. (IQ2US), "Obesity Is The Government's Business." With 33 percent of adults and 17 percent of children obese, the U.S. is currently facing an obesity epidemic. A major risk factor of expensive, chronic conditions like heart disease, diabetes and cancer, it costs our health care system nearly $150 billon a year. This Oxford-style debate will ask: Should the government intervene, or is this a matter of individual rights and personal responsibility?

In support of the motion:
Dr. David Satcher, Former Surgeon General of the United States
Dr. Pamela Peeke, WebMD Chief Lifestyle Expert
Against the motion:
Paul Campos, Author of The Obesity Myth and Law Professor, University of Colorado
John Stossel, FOX Business News Anchor & Commentator
The Moderator: John Donvan is a correspondent for ABC News’ “Nightline.” In a career that spans more than two decades for ABC News, Donvan previously served as the Chief White House Correspondent, along with postings in Moscow, London, Jerusalem and Amman.
